The Business Landscape
Nanak Foods engaged KIRAH to support the appointment of a Director of Operations – US & Canada during a major stage of organizational growth and cross border operational expansion.
At the time of the search, the organization was establishing a brand new manufacturing facility in Bellingham, Washington as part of its broader North American growth strategy. The expansion represented a significant operational milestone as the company continued strengthening its manufacturing, distribution, and production capabilities across both Canadian and US markets.
Leadership required an operations executive capable of helping oversee complex manufacturing environments while supporting facility setup, operational integration, production scalability, and cross border coordination initiatives.
The mandate carried substantial importance as the organization continued investing in infrastructure growth and operational modernization within a highly competitive food manufacturing environment.
The Leadership Requirement
The role required far more than traditional plant or production management capability.
Nanak Foods needed a senior operational leader capable of navigating manufacturing expansion, operational scaling, team leadership, and cross border operational coordination across Canada and the United States.
The ideal candidate required strong experience across food manufacturing operations, facility leadership, operational efficiency, process management, and large scale production environments.
Equally important was the need for an executive capable of supporting the launch and stabilization of a new facility while partnering closely with executive leadership during a critical growth phase.

The Search Strategy
KIRAH conducted focused outreach targeting operations executives across food manufacturing, production, consumer packaged goods, and industrial operational sectors throughout Canada and the United States.
The process emphasized identifying leaders with experience managing complex production environments and operational scaling initiatives.
Candidates were evaluated beyond operational management experience alone.
The assessment process focused heavily on leadership maturity, facility startup capability, manufacturing oversight, operational problem solving, team leadership, and scalability mindset.
Particular emphasis was placed on identifying a leader capable of helping support a newly established US facility while aligning operations across both countries.
The search process also prioritized alignment with Nanak Foods’ entrepreneurial environment, growth trajectory, and operational culture.
Candidates were assessed on adaptability, collaboration capability, leadership style, and their ability to operate effectively within a rapidly evolving manufacturing environment.
The Appointment
The search resulted in the successful appointment of a Director of Operations – US & Canada for Nanak Foods.
The selected executive brought strong manufacturing leadership capability, operational experience, and cross functional management strength aligned with the organization’s North American growth initiatives.
The appointment helped strengthen operational leadership infrastructure during a pivotal stage as the company established and scaled its new Bellingham, Washington facility while continuing broader expansion efforts across Canada and the United States.
